Output 1a31d03482912ba98698412fbdca46a3aafa7b7786071b28ec23a12f4ddc16e7:1

value
11520840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3af9e50d427b7a41d9f86fdd59650b65a220b1a OP_EQUAL
address
MQHFZx2pKEzmKwvZaNN4EnzjDhzwMh8wiL
transaction
1a31d03482912ba98698412fbdca46a3aafa7b7786071b28ec23a12f4ddc16e7
spent
true